Holley (HLLY) - 2025 Q1 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-05-07 13:32
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company achieved net sales of $153 million, representing a 3.3% increase in the core business compared to the prior year [13][45] - Gross margins improved to 41.9%, an increase of 910 basis points from 32.8% in the prior year [14][46] - Free cash flow for the quarter was negative $10.8 million, a decrease of $28.6 million compared to the prior year [15][48] - Adjusted EBITDA margin improved to 17.8%, an increase of 460 basis points from the prior year [16][48]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- The direct-to-consumer channel saw significant growth with more than a 10% increase, while third-party platforms like Amazon and eBay experienced growth of over 50% [12][21] - The B2B channel strengthened relationships with partners, resulting in over 2.5% growth [11][21] - The domestic muscle vertical experienced a 3% year-over-year growth, with power brands averaging an impressive 11% growth [21]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company is gaining market share despite a challenging macroeconomic environment, with no material pre-buy observed from customers in the second quarter [9][10] - The overall consumer sentiment has declined, indicating growing concerns regarding inflation and economic viability, which could moderate spending in the near term [50]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company is focused on operational excellence and cash flow optimization, with a strategic framework that includes enhancing customer relationships and product innovation [22][43] - The company is actively managing costs to offset tariff impacts, including spend optimization and operational improvements [30][36] - The strategic initiatives have driven $15 million in revenue across key areas and achieved $3.1 million in cost reductions [29]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management noted that the financial health of consumers shows signs of strain, which could impact discretionary spending [50][51] - The company is maintaining its revenue guidance for 2025, expecting $580 million to $600 million, implying approximately 2.5% growth at the midpoint [52] Other Important Information - The company launched several new products across various divisions, contributing approximately $8.1 million in revenue for the quarter [12][17] - The company is on track with its Mexico market expansion, having signed up 15 distributors [27] Q&A Session Summary Question: How does Holley's sourcing mix and capabilities to respond differ from peers? - Management highlighted that Holley's breadth and depth of product across various categories positions it well to gain market share, especially with most production costs based in the U.S. [55] Question: What has been the feedback to the price increase announced in early April? - Overall feedback has been positive, with distribution partners appreciating the blended approach across the portfolio compared to competitors who have implemented larger price increases [58] Question: Can you elaborate on the moderation in demand witnessed through the first quarter? - Management noted that while January and February were slow due to weather conditions, March saw strong performance, and there have been no significant changes in demand trends since then [65] Question: How much exposure does the company have to China regarding tariffs? - Management stated that while most production costs are U.S.-based, the situation is fluid, and the company is actively working to mitigate tariff impacts [90] Question: Can you provide more details on the changes to Holly events? - The company is optimizing events to enhance customer experiences and increase revenue through VIP experiences and improved merchandising [94]
